Summer School

a week of creativity, fun and performance

Dates:
Week One
for 7 to 10 yr olds
Mon 30 Jul – Fri 3 Aug, 10am to 4pm

OR

Week Two
for 11 to 13 yr olds
Mon 6 Aug – Fri 10 Aug, 10am to 4pm

The Everyman and Playhouse Summer School is a great opportunity for children interested in drama and acting to have fun in a professional theatre environment. At the summer school, children will build confidence, communication skills and acting skills – whilst making new friends and stretching their imaginations.

Professional theatre practitioners will use acting exercises and games to develop skills in Voice, Movement, Improvisation and Storytelling, culminating in a short performance piece at the end of each week.

All abilities are welcome, no performance or acting experience necessary. All sessions are run by professional practitioners with industry experience in directing and acting who have been CRB checked.

Last year’s summer school saw children from all over Merseyside enjoy a week of fun and creativity finishing with a sharing of their work.
